Abstract | An interdisciplinary faculty team from the St. Louis College of Pharmacy (Missouri) and Albany College of Pharmacy (New York) collaborated in integrating a course on herbal products with a course on critical thinking. The collaboration was designed to improve students' professional critical thinking, communication, and ethical decision-making skills. Portfolios, surveys, testing, and course evaluations indicated students improved targeted skills. (Author/DB) |
